Professor Lecture "Star and Planet Formation - How Planets and Stars Were Born -"

The stars shining in the night sky also had their time of birth. How were the stars that make up constellations and the sun born, and through what processes? Were celestial bodies such as the planets orbiting the sun born in the same way? This section clearly explains the answers revealed by astronomy since the 1970s and the remaining mysteries, using numerous images to make the findings easy to understand.

Contents
Content of Each Session
1st January 24 Interstellar Matter: The Hidden Force Behind Star Formation
Outer space is not a perfect vacuum; it contains sparse gases. This section introduces what these gases look like, their nature, and how their existence was discovered.
2nd February 28 Star Formation: How the Sun and Other Stars Are Made
How were the sun and stars born in the universe? This section introduces research findings based on observations about that process, along with numerous images.
3rd March 28 Planet Formation: How Earth and Saturn Are Made
Planets and asteroids orbit around the sun. How were they formed? We present the answers revealed by the latest science.
